area a is located close to a volcanic vent, but area b is far away. what is the expected distribution of iron ore deposits in each area? a. area a will have higher iron ore deposits than area b. b. area b will have higher iron ore deposits than area a. c. area a and area b will have nearly the same amount of iron ore deposits. d. its not possible to predict the distribution of iron ore deposits in this situation.

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

Volcanic activity can bring iron - rich materials to the surface. Since area A is close to a volcanic vent, it is more likely to have higher iron ore deposits due to volcanic processes that can concentrate and deposit such minerals. Area B, being far away, is less likely to be affected by these volcanic - related iron - ore depositing processes.

Answer:

A. Area A will have higher iron ore deposits than area B.
